Medicare patients need to make good choices when picking their secondary coverage. Patients tend to think that “Part D” will take care of all of their drug costs. Many rheumatic disease patients who take costly medications are unaware of the hidden costs through Medicare Part D. Finding the right drug coverage can mean that a patient will not need to worry about the “donut hole”. Consider buying your drug coverage separately from Medicare. By having their secondary supplemental policy cover their drugs (but you have to be sure it covers the medications-not Part D Medicare), most patients are able to forgo the “donut hole” and to use drug company copay cards to help with the cost, potentially saving a lot of money and giving them more choices.
